I read a story about pure selflessness. A college student by the name of Cameron Lyle is an athlete at the University of New Hampshire. He has made the decision to give up his athletic career to save a man’s life. Lyle entered the bone marrow registry a few years ago, and just got a call that he was a match for a man that had about 6 months to live without the transplant. Lyle said it was pretty much a no brainer. He said the opportunity to save someone’s life like this doesn’t happen very often and that any decent human being would take the risk and donate.
